Once in Miami, you can take advantage of one of the most convenient ways to get around the city center—the free automated Metromover train. The "Bayfront Park" station is located right at the park entrance, making access incredibly simple. Additionally, numerous city buses stop in the immediate vicinity, allowing you to reach the park easily from almost anywhere in the metropolis.
If you are traveling by car, the park is easy to find using road signs or any navigation app. There are several public parking lots in and around the park area where you can leave your car. Alternatively, you can always choose a taxi or ridesharing services—an especially convenient option for those wanting to reach the park directly from the airport or neighboring cities without transfers.

History & Facts
The history of Bayfront Park is closely intertwined with the development of Miami itself, which is located near Hollywood. Work on the park began in 1924, and its official opening to the public took place in March 1925. The original design was developed by architect Warren Henry Manning, who envisioned it as one of the first public spaces for the growing city's residents. From its inception, the park became a center for cultural and social life, a place to relax on the shores of scenic Biscayne Bay.
The park acquired its modern and recognizable look in the 1980s following a large-scale renovation. The project was led by the world-renowned Japanese-American sculptor and landscape designer Isamu Noguchi. It was he who brought elements of modernism to the park's design, creating unique art objects such as the Challenger Memorial and the Light Tower. Thanks to his vision, Bayfront Park was transformed from a simple green space into a true open-air work of art, harmoniously blending nature and sculpture.
Beyond its cultural significance, the park witnessed one of the most dramatic moments in the history of the USA. On February 15, 1933, an assassination attempt on President-elect Franklin D. Roosevelt took place right here. During the politician's speech, anarchist Giuseppe Zangara opened fire. Roosevelt himself was unharmed, but the Mayor of Chicago, Anton Cermak, who was standing nearby, was mortally wounded. This event forever inscribed Bayfront Park into the annals of American history.
Time Needed
When planning a visit to Bayfront Park, you should allow for one and a half to three hours. This amount of time will be quite sufficient for a leisurely stroll along the scenic paths, viewing key sculptures and art objects, and enjoying the beautiful views of Biscayne Bay. If you are short on time, even a quick one-hour walk will give you a general impression of this green oasis.
However, if you want to make the most of your experience, your stay can easily be extended. For example, if your visit coincides with one of the many concerts or festivals regularly held at the park's amphitheater, or if you decide to take one of the boat tours of the bay that depart from here, feel free to set aside at least three hours or even half a day. You should also consider time for the playground or relaxing on the small sandy beach adjacent to the park.
